1. Understanding Intestinal Worm Infections
Intestinal worms are parasites that live and feed in the human digestive tract. Common species include:
- Roundworms (Ascaris lumbricoides)
- Whipworms (Trichuris trichiura)
- Hookworms (Ancylostoma duodenale, Necator americanus)
- Pinworms (Enterobius vermicularis)
These worms can be transmitted through contaminated food, water, soil, or direct contact with infected individuals. Infections often lead to symptoms such as:
- Abdominal pain
- Diarrhea
- Itching around the anus (especially with pinworms)
- Fatigue and weakness
- Malnutrition and weight loss in severe cases
2. What Is Mebendazole?
Mebendazole is an anthelmintic drug, meaning it is designed to expel parasitic worms from the body. It is available in:
- Tablet form (chewable or swallowable)
- Liquid suspension for children or those who have difficulty swallowing tablets
It is commonly prescribed as a single-dose treatment for mild infections or as a short course for more stubborn infestations.
3. How Mebendazole Works: The Mechanism of Action
The way mebendazole eliminates worms is based on blocking their nutrient absorption.
Here’s the step-by-step process:
- Binding to Parasite Microtubules
- Mebendazole binds to the structural proteins (microtubules) in the cells of the worm.
- Blocking Glucose Uptake
- This binding prevents the parasite from absorbing glucose, which is its main energy source.
- Depleting Energy Stores
- Without glucose, the worm’s energy stores run out quickly, making it unable to survive.
- Paralysis and Death
- The worms become immobile and eventually die inside the intestine.
- Natural Elimination
- Dead worms are passed out of the body through normal bowel movements.
Unlike some worm treatments that instantly paralyze the parasites, mebendazole works gradually, which helps reduce inflammation caused by sudden worm death.
4. Effectiveness Against Different Worm Types
Mebendazole is considered a broad-spectrum anthelmintic because it works against multiple species:
- Highly effective for: Pinworms, roundworms, whipworms
- Moderately effective for: Hookworms, threadworms
- Less effective for: Certain tapeworms (other drugs like albendazole or praziquantel may be preferred)
5. How Long Does It Take to Work?
- For pinworms, symptoms like itching may improve within 24–48 hours, but the full course is needed to prevent reinfection.
- For roundworms and whipworms, significant improvement is usually seen within a few days, with complete clearance in 1–3 weeks.
- For mixed infections, several days to weeks may be needed, depending on severity.
6. Dosage and Treatment Guidelines
Typical dosing varies depending on the infection type:
- Pinworms: 100 mg single dose; repeat in 2 weeks if needed.
- Roundworms, whipworms, hookworms: 100 mg twice daily for 3 days.
- Mixed infections: As advised by a healthcare provider.
Administration tips:
- Chew the tablet completely or crush it before swallowing (unless using suspension).
- Can be taken with or without food.
- Avoid skipping doses during a multi-day course.
7. Safety and Side Effects
Mebendazole is generally well tolerated, but possible side effects include:
- Mild stomach pain or cramps
- Diarrhea
- Nausea
- Headache
Rare but serious side effects (seek medical attention if these occur):
- Severe allergic reaction (rash, swelling, breathing problems)
- Liver problems (yellowing of skin/eyes, dark urine)
- Severe abdominal pain or persistent vomiting
8. Precautions and Contraindications
Mebendazole may not be suitable for:
- Pregnant women, especially in the first trimester
- People with known allergies to benzimidazole drugs
- Individuals with severe liver disease
Children over 2 years old can usually take mebendazole, but younger children may require alternative treatments.
9. Preventing Reinfection
Even after successful treatment, worm infections can return if hygiene measures are not followed. To prevent reinfection:
- Wash hands thoroughly after using the toilet and before eating.
- Keep fingernails short and clean.
- Wash bed linens, clothes, and towels regularly.
- Treat all family members if one is infected (especially for pinworms).
- Avoid walking barefoot in areas where hookworm is common.
10. Role in Public Health
Mebendazole is used in mass deworming programs in schools and communities, especially in regions where worm infections are widespread. These campaigns help reduce:
- Malnutrition in children
- School absenteeism due to illness
- Community transmission of parasites
